Does anybody else do this?

Whenever an I get an idea like "I should take up swimming every day" or "Maybe I should only have one tab open at a time," or even "Should I buy a new dining room table?" my instinct is to rush online and read everything I can find about the lifestyle change I want to make, research products and possible solutions. I frantically eat up any blog post, forum discussion, youtube video or podcast about the topic. Thing is, I've been reading about minimalism and productivity and simple living for about five years now, so chances are good that I've ALREADY read the articles!

Since I've noticed this behavioural pattern, I've started applying mindfulness; I acknowledge and observe my impulse and let it pass. I tell myself to actually apply the idea opposed to passively living through testimonials written by people who did. It's kinda like how people want to see weight loss or fitness progress IMMEDIATELY.

My theory is that it's kinda like how your brain gets the same reward by telling someone about going to the gym as going to the gym, so you don't actually follow through with going to the gym.

Sharing because I haven't heard discussions of behavioural patterns like this on these forums and was wondering if anyone else does the same thing.
